6 Vital Content Writing Basics!

Content writing is one of the most rewarding professions because you are the “creator” of your content! And, any creative process is satisfying. Also, it helps you increase your knowledge on different topics by giving you the opportunity to go deeper into them.

Let’s look at some of the basics of professional content writing:

1. Fluency in English: If you want to start your career as a content writer, make sure you are familiar with all the rules of grammar, syntax, and all aspects related to English grammar.

2. Optimize with keywords: Professional content writing is mainly about using relevant keywords intelligently in content so that it is well optimized for search engines. In a nutshell, your content should include those words that will be used by your audience searching for a specific product or service in order for it to rank high in search engines. For example, if your goal is to market the services of a real estate agent, you’ll want to use keywords like “sell a house” or “buy a house”, real estate agent, real estate agency, etc.

3. Know your audience: To find keywords relevant to your product or service, you’ll need to put yourself in the customer’s shoes. Imagine that you are the buyer and think about what specific words you would use to search for that product or service. This will give you an idea of ​​the relevant keywords for your content. Also, you can use tools that help in generating keywords.

4. Research the topic: When you write about any topic, make sure you study it in depth to gain a clear understanding. You can pass on information about a product or service only if you know about it. Research can be time consuming because you need to browse through different websites and understand the topic. Once again, think from the reader’s perspective when creating content. It also provides all the details that a person looking for information about the product/service might require.

5. Check your content: Some of the essential checks you need for your content are plagiarism and grammar checking to ensure that the content is 100% unique and free of grammatical errors. There are various tools available for this purpose.

6. Edit the content: Even after checking the content with the tools, you’ll need to check to make sure everything is in order.
